A gentle shift toward personalization

One of the most exciting developments in modern education is the move toward personalized learning. In the past, classrooms often resembled a one-size-fits-all model, where students were expected to absorb information at the same pace and in the same manner. This approach, while practical in some respects, often overlooked the unique strengths and interests of individual learners.

Today, educators are increasingly recognizing the value of tailoring experiences to meet the diverse needs of their students. With the help of technology, personalized learning plans can be crafted, allowing learners to progress at their own pace. This shift not only empowers students but also fosters a deeper connection to the material. When learners can explore subjects that resonate with their passions, the process becomes less about rote memorization and more about genuine curiosity and engagement.

Integrating mindfulness and well-being

As we delve deeper into the fabric of modern education, we can’t overlook the growing emphasis on mindfulness and well-being. Recognizing that mental health plays a crucial role in academic success, many educational institutions are beginning to incorporate practices that promote emotional resilience and self-awareness.

Mindfulness exercises, such as meditation or deep-breathing techniques, are being introduced into the daily routine, allowing students to cultivate a sense of calm and focus. These practices not only enhance concentration but also provide valuable tools for managing stress. By prioritizing mental well-being, educators are fostering a holistic approach to learning that acknowledges the interconnectedness of mind, body, and spirit.

Fostering a growth mindset

In this new era of education, the concept of a growth mindset is gaining traction. This philosophy, popularized by psychologist Carol Dweck, emphasizes the belief that abilities and intelligence can be developed through dedication and hard work. Rather than viewing challenges as obstacles, students are encouraged to see them as opportunities for growth and learning.

By nurturing a growth mindset, educators are helping students cultivate resilience and a love for lifelong learning. This shift in perspective not only empowers individuals to embrace challenges but also fosters a sense of curiosity that extends far beyond the classroom walls. When students understand that failure is not the end but a stepping stone toward success, they are more likely to take risks and pursue their passions with vigor.
